Montpelier, VT - (April 15, 2024) National Life Group released its 2023 Annual Report, which highlights new sales records set despite market volatility, as well product innovation and expanded community support.

We continue to grow with purpose while consistently outpacing our competition even with market volatility. At the same time, we have expanded efforts to combat childhood hunger, support youth mental health and build communities nationwide,” Chairman, CEO and President Mehran Assadi said. “We know our associates are our competitive advantage, our ‘secret sauce.’ They are essential to our mission-driven and purposeful culture, enabling us to serve Middle America.”

Among the accomplishments noted in the report:

  • Set new sales records:
    • $530 million in life insurance policies
    • $2.7 billion in Single Premium Deferred Annuities
    • $220 million in flow annuity business
  • $47 billion in assets under management
  • $471 million in core earnings
  • Pioneered the introduction of two innovative living benefits riders1: a new Accelerated Benefits Alzheimer’s Disease rider and a first of its kind Fertility Journey rider
  • $1.73 million raised for Vermont flood relief through Do Good Fest
